Possible Causes of Water Damage

Water damage in homes and businesses around Medulla can stem from various sources. One common cause is plumbing leaks or burst pipes, especially during colder months when pipes are more vulnerable. These leaks often go unnoticed until significant damage occurs, leading to mold growth and structural issues. Additionally, malfunctioning appliances like washing machines, dishwashers, or water heaters can leak and cause hidden water buildup over time. Heavy rainfalls and storms in Florida can also overwhelm drainage systems, resulting in flooding that infiltrates homes and damages property.

Another frequent cause of water damage is roof leaks. Due to intense weather conditions, roofs may develop cracks or missing shingles that allow water to seep into the attic or ceiling. Poor drainage around the property can cause water to pool near foundations, eventually penetrating basements or crawl spaces. Faulty gutters and downspouts that don’t direct water away from the structure can exacerbate these issues. Regardless of the cause, timely identification and repair are essential to prevent long-term damage and costly restoration efforts.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I know if I have water damage?

Signs of water damage include visible stains on walls or ceilings, musty odors, and warped or buckling flooring. Hidden leaks may cause mold growth or increased humidity in certain areas of your property. If you notice any of these signs, it’s advisable to schedule a professional inspection immediately.

How long does water damage restoration take?

The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the size of the affected area. Minor leaks can often be resolved within a couple of days, while extensive flooding or structural repairs may take a week or more. Our experts will provide an estimated timeline after a thorough assessment.

Will my insurance cover water damage repairs?

Most homeowner’s insurance policies cover sudden water damage caused by plumbing failures or storm-related flooding. However, damages resulting from neglected maintenance or gradual leaks might not be covered. We recommend reviewing your policy and consulting with your insurer to understand your coverage options.

Can you help prevent future water damage?

Absolutely. Our team not only inspects current issues but also offers recommendations for preventive measures. These include maintenance tips, improvements to drainage systems, and recommendations for waterproofing vulnerable areas to protect your property long-term.
